0.3.3 Beta

Rating:        Based on 5 ratings
Reviewed:  2 reviews
Downloads: 2749
Released: Mar 8, 2009
Updated: Mar 7, 2009 by friism
Dev status: Beta Help Icon

Recommended Download

Source Code LinqtoCRM.zip
source code, 459K, uploaded Mar 7, 2009 - 2749 downloads

Release Notes

From readme
Welcome to LinqtoCRM

Getting Started

* Add the following files from the LinqtoCRM project to your project: CrmQueryProvider.cs, CrmWebService.cs, 
	Evaluator.cs, ExpressionVisitor.cs, IService.cs, ProjectionBuilder.cs, QueryFormatter.cs, QueryProvider.cs, 
	TypeSystem.cs, StunnwareExtensions.cs
* Add CrmWebService.cs and XmlIndentingWriter.cs (can be omitted) from the LinqtoCRMApplication project to your project
* Correct the name of the webservice reference in CrmWebService.cs
* Add a reference to stunnware.CRM.Fetch.dll (found in the stunnware.CRM.Fetch project).
* Add "using LinqtoCRM;"

Start Coding!

The current project was built with VS 2008 RTM and is known to work against CRM 4.0 RTM. CRM 3.0 should still be supported.

Check the codeplex page for updates: http://www.codeplex.com/LinqtoCRM

Found a query you think should work, but LinqtoCRM breaks or returns the wrong data? Please 
send it to me at friism+linqtocrm@gmail.com or create a workitem on the codeplex site.


* Michael Friis (initial version, maintenance)
* Michael Höhne (fixes to result parsing code, provided FetchXML lib)
* Mel Gerats (implemented paging with skip/take, chained queries, contains, count and many other improvements to the code)
* Petteri Räty (rewrote query generation code, improved support for projections and conditions)

Michael Friis

Reviews for this release

Very useful. I have only worked with simple queries and love it so far. I don't know how it would work for complex queries.
by palamr on Jul 5, 2009 at 3:42 PM
by johnjohn7666 on Apr 3, 2009 at 6:13 AM